commew / timelogger-web

時間記録アプリ
https://timmew.commew.net
MIT License
2 stars 0 forks source link

タスクアイテムコンポーネントに時間計測ロジックを追加した #111

Closed kuniyuki-f closed 1 year ago

kuniyuki-f commented 1 year ago

issueURL

81

この PR で対応する範囲 / この PR で対応しない範囲

タスクアイテムコンポーネントに時間計測ロジックを追加しました。 初回レンダリング時のステータスに応じて以下のように処理を実装しています。

今回のPRではタイマーに関する停止・終了機能は実装しません。

Storybook の URL、 スクリーンショット

Aug-25-2023 20-56-34

変更点概要

TODO で放置していたタスクアイテムコンポーネントの時間計測ロジックを追加しました。 最初はタイマーコンポーネントみたいな形で実装しようと思っていましたが、 ロジックの要素が強かったのでカスタムフックで実装しました。

レビュアーに重点的にチェックして欲しい点

ソースコードにコメントで記載します。

補足情報

とくになし

vercel[bot] commented 1 year ago

The latest updates on your projects. Learn more about Vercel for Git ↗︎

Name Status Preview Comments Updated (UTC)
timelogger-web ✅ Ready (Inspect) Visit Preview 💬 Add feedback Aug 26, 2023 3:11am
keitakn commented 1 year ago

@c501306014

すいません、以下の要因から一旦レビューは待ってください🙏

こちら見落としていました、すいません💦

ちなみにこういう場合はPRをDraft状態にすれば分かりやすいかと思います👍

https://zenn.dev/inabajunmr/articles/9a683214fa32cc

(もしかして権限がないとかですかね?)

kuniyuki-f commented 1 year ago

@keitakn

レビューありがとうございます🙇

こちら見落としていました、すいません💦 ちなみにこういう場合はPRをDraft状態にすれば分かりやすいかと思います👍 https://zenn.dev/inabajunmr/articles/9a683214fa32cc

とんでもないです! こちらこそややこしくしてしまってすいません! またアドバイスありがとうございます!

(もしかして権限がないとかですかね?)

私が先ほど確認したところ、 既に Draft に変わってたんですが、 keita さんが変更して下さったんでしょうか??👀

既に Draft になっているので、今の画面だと権限があるのか不明ですが、 次回から PR の状態に気を付けておくようにします!🙏 もし万一権限がなかったらむちょこさんに権限付与依頼します👍

問題が解決したらまたレビュー依頼出します。 その際はどうぞよろしくお願いします🙇

image

keitakn commented 1 year ago

@c501306014 ご確認ありがとうございます👌はい、先程自分の方でdraftに変えておきました!

共有してなくてごめんなさい🙏

kuniyuki-f commented 1 year ago

@keitakn

下記について無事解決しました! ( コードの変更は 3e901cc91d54bc0e38be51c35db1adb0e3d8060a のみです! )

Vercel のデプロイがこけている

Vercel で Redeploy したら解決しました。 ログにネットワークエラーのような記録があったので、一時的な問題だったようです。

TaskItem コンポーネントの Storybook を更新しないと時間が Nan になってしまう

3e901cc91d54bc0e38be51c35db1adb0e3d8060a で対応しました!

Draft を外しますので、お手隙で再度レビューをお願い致します! (ちゃんと自分でもDraftに変更できそうです👀) image